Intel Core i7 8700K vs Intel Core i3 6100

We compared two desktop CPUs: Intel Core i7 8700K with 6 cores 3.7GHz and Intel Core i3 6100 with 2 cores 3.7G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

Intel Core i7 8700K 's Advantages
Released 2 years and 1 months late
Higher specification of memory (2666 vs 2133)
Larger memory bandwidth (41.6GB/s vs 34.1GB/s)
Larger L3 cache size (12MB vs 3MB)
Intel Core i3 6100 's Advantages
Lower TDP (51W vs 95W)
